I've got the rio125 atm and wanna upgrade to about twice as big so am looking at the rio240 range. On seapets the tank is 300 and aquariums delivered 355 but the AD one has the new T5 light system with it which the other one doesn't and as I wish to introduce more plants into this tank I've gathered the T5 will be more beneficial towards this..

So.... my question is which one to get for the best price, if I go with seapets should I upgrade my lights and will this end up being cheaper than the orginal AD price? I have no experience in fitting lights so don't really know how much it would cost to do this. Or are the new T5 lights another selling gimmick which won't actually make much difference?

the t5's are not a gimmick but good old Juwel has put a spanner in the works, as far as iv read you can only replace them with Juwel tubes (which aren't cheap) as no other make of tube will fit. unlike the old style t8 light bar where any t8 tube would fit.

I dare say some company will start producing tubes at some point to under cut Juwel..

I know they say change you lights every 9 to 12 month but im unsure if t5's fall under it, if they do it would be worth checking to see how much it will be to replace the tubes..

another idea is to see how much the Arcadia light bar is ,if you don't already know , this replaces the t8 light bar with t5 lighting and you can still use the original flaps. might work out about the same as the extra that aquariums delivered want, but you would need to buy t5 tubes, might work out more expensive in the short term but in the long term work out cheaper as you don't have to pay Juwel prices for new tubes every year or so..

Edit : scrap that idea m8, the Juwel light bar is 2 x 54 and the Arcadia i bar is 2 x 38w plus its £90 without tubes, so looks like your better sticking with the Juwel hi light system. juwel light system would give 1.7 wpg and the i bar would give 1.2wpg. only thing you will need is a set of reflectors..
 
By the way all Juwel tanks on Seapets actually have T5s now!

I know it says T8s but I sent them an email and they said all their Juwel Tanks (except Rekords of course) are now T5s.

I have proof because I ordered a Lido 120 from them and it does indeed have the T5s.

So you're fine in the first place.
